# Build Provenance: Parity Between Wrenlet SDKs

The Wrenlet Swift and Kotlin SDKs must ship from the same spec snapshot. Parity is verified by the cross-check job, which diffs generated method signatures and flags drift. If the job fails, do not tag either SDK; regenerate both from the canonical spec and rerun. Historical drift incidents are logged on the Parity Ledger page. Every parity-approved release records the spec hash in its manifest. The current verified pair corresponds to the token below.

pipeline stamp: htk9_6ce9d33c5

### CSV Import Wizard — triage notes

Heads up: the Fernhollow import wizard chokes on files with mixed line endings, so if a customer ticket mentions "stuck at step 2," that's usually it. Re-run the normalizer job, then requeue the import from the staging table. Don't delete rows from import_batches by hand — the wizard tracks offsets there. The requeue script talks to staging using the connection string that follows.

primary connection of tajeg-tajop = postgresql://julax_svc:DI@db-e7f3.kelvidyn.corp:5432/rusdor

## Data stores: Feedproof

Feedproof, our podcast feed validator, keeps parsed feed metadata and validation results in a single Postgres instance named `castcheck-primary`. Episode-level warnings are retained for 90 days; feed-level history is kept indefinitely. Read replicas handle the public status page. For local debugging, new team members can query the primary directly using the connection string below.

primary connection of yagep-kahip = redis://giliel_svc:zYiKsLL2PLpfPL@db-348f.xolmarsys.corp:5432/fenwyn

Subject: Ormwright cut-over — done!

Hi all (especially the new folks),

The legacy ORM layer is officially retired as of last night. Beaconry services now go through the Ormwright adapter, and the old query builder is frozen read-only in the attic branch. Rollback window stays open two weeks, but honestly it went smoother than expected — one hiccup with lazy-loaded joins, patched by Nadia. If you're setting up locally, the adapter expects the following settings.

config for taguf-tafof:
zorath:
  log_level: error
  metrics_host: metrics.zorath.zemvarlabs.internal
  pin: 5550
  pool_size: 32